Quality plan for software product

Originally referred to as advanced quality planning aqp, apqp is used by progressive companies to assure quality and performance through planning. This plan describes the quality assurance qa organization and audit, evaluation and. Another purpose of a plan is to achieve the quality of the project being executed. Nick lappos, chief research and development pilot, sikorski aircraft a quality plan describes how an organisation will achieve its quality objectives. Create and share live roadmaps with just a few clicks. This template is a sample from the cvrit consulting llc template library. How to create a quality plan template in four steps. A quality control plan may specify product tolerances, testing parameters, and acceptance criteria. This sqap software quality assurance plan covers all important aspects of software development.

The stakeholder register documents stakeholders with an interest or impact on quality. The american society for quality asq recommends a plan, do, check, act qa model. Quickly update your roadmap in realtime as decisions are made. Present a compelling story with beautiful, visual roadmaps. This software category can refer to a broad range of. It describes emd quality assurance activities performed by qa staff, directed by documented procedures. The term quality assurance describes a set of planned, systematic actions to ensure that products and services comply with specified requirements.

The sqa plan document consists of the below sections. The software quality assurance plan sqap establishes the quality assurance program for the emd contract. Qcbd dramatically reduces the cost of achieving and maintaining compliance to quality management standards such as iso 9001, iso 485, as9100, ts 16949 and sqf 2000 iso 22000. Advanced product quality planning apqp is a structured process aimed at ensuring customer satisfaction with new products or processes. It is a corrective tool used to find and eliminate sources of quality problems so that a clients requirements are met before the software system is formally deployed. The main purpose of a quality plan is to establish the quality of a project, product or service to meet the customers expectation regarding the quality and the satisfaction made. Quality planning quality plan software quality management. The purpose of this software quality assurance plan sqap is to define the techniques, procedures, and methodologies that will be used at the center for space research csr to assure timely delivery of the software that meets specified requirements within project resources. Quickly update your roadmap in realtime as decisions are. Software quality management sqm is a management process that aims to develop and manage the quality of software in such a way so as to best ensure that the product meets. A qa plan should be designed specifically for your business and improve existing procedures. Software quality management sqm is a management process that aims to develop and manage the quality of software in such a way so as to best ensure that the product meets the quality standards expected by the customer while also meeting any necessary regulatory and developer requirements, if any.

Software quality assurance plan for the emd project. It describes the activities and resources necessary for the project management team to achieve the quality objectives set for the project pmbok. The paper describes project quality management for large software development programs. Sample quality management plan act if performance measures thresholds are exceeded, take specific corrective actions to fix the systemic cause of any nonconformance, deficiency, or other unwanted. Apqp has existed for decades in many forms and practices. Software quality assurance plan people kansas state university. He specifies persons in his organization who are responsible for the individual activities and stipulates the corresponding deadlines. Quality management software qms can help manufacturers measure and therefore improve the quality of their products and processes.

Managing project quality requires an approved quality plan encompassing three. Apr 29, 2020 software quality assurance is about engineering process that ensures quality software testing is to test a product for problems before the product goes live involves activities related to the implementation of processes, procedures, and standards. If you are new to the business we recommend you gather all the available information about your companys product. Product quality plan example qualitative quantitative. Common standards, regulations, and procedures to confirm work products during sdlc. Product quality plan requirements certmark international. Quality assurance program plan, basic systems, implement iso 9001. The requirements and activities identified herein, form the basis for the development of project unique product assurance plans paps. This software category can refer to a broad range of applications that help manufacturers ensure quality across all supply chain activitiesfrom design to production to distribution and eventually, service. Describes the characteristics of the product such as size, complexity, design features, performance, and quality level. Mar 09, 2011 the first step for creating a project quality plan template requires you to find out what the customer of your project expects to receive at the projects end. Use the following sections to identify the project quality plan components or modify these sections to meet your needs.

Lead doc writer has submitted a documentation plan that includes a xpage manual, online reference and list all components. How to develop a quality management plan project risk coach. Quality assurance qa is defined as an activity to ensure that an organization is providing the best possible product or service to customers. The transform software quality plan outlines the processes which should be undertaken so that when software output from this project moves towards commercial exploitation, potential partners will. These characteristics can be used to improve the development and maintenance activities of the software. On the customers side, the technical departments depending on their area of responsibility or designated project supervisors are responsible for cooperation with. A quality assurance plan contains a set of documented activities meant to ensure that customers are. Software quality assurance vs software quality plan software. While the terminology may differ, the basic approach is similar. The customer is the primary source of information on what the product should look like.

This qa plan is a communication vehicle for the entire project team, including. The risk register can identify events that can negatively impact project or product quality. Software quality assurance plan sqap consists of those procedures, techniques and tools used to ensure that a product meets the requirements specified in. The purpose of the quality management plan is to describe how quality will be managed throughout the lifecycle of the project. Quality control plan project quality control plan 1. An example of a software quality assurance plan developed from an actual doe project sqa plan based on doe g 200. Steps to developing a project quality plan template. Quality control, on the other hand, is a productoriented process that is done to identify the defects in the finished product. Requirements for a p roduct quality plan a product quality plan pqp is a requirement, under both the type test and codemark scheme s, which has been written in line with iso5.

The purpose of this writing guide is to define the structure and content for project management and quality plans pmqps to be used by ida projects and their suppliers internal or external of software. The team members are responsible for following the quality standards laid out while developing the application, documenting the results, monitoring the project progress, and testing the project quality. Product knowledge is listed as the first item in the quality assurance program plan. Currently, plan calls for x testers be assigned to the product. It is a corrective tool used to find and eliminate sources of quality problems so that a. Sqa is an ongoing process within the software development lifecycle.

It not only involves checking the final quality of products to avoid defects, as is the case in quality control, but also checking product quality in. An organization has to ensure, that processes are efficient and effective as per the quality standards defined for. Software quality control is the function that checks whether the software project follows its standards processes, and procedures, and that the project produces the desired internal and external. It also includes the processes and procedures for ensuring quality planning, assurance, and control are all conducted. Productplan is the easiest way to plan, visualize, and communicate your product strategy. This document is the deliverable software quality assurance plan. Through communicating with the customer you need to define the expectations and set up quality. By signing this document, they agree to this as the formal project quality plan document. Its mission is to help software professionals apply quality principles to the development and use of software and software based systems. Steps to developing a project quality plan template by eric mcconnell published march 30, 2011 updated august 9, 2012 without appropriate project quality planning its hard to imagine a successful project that delivers a stated product as per specifications and in compliance with stakeholder requirements. Quality control, on the other hand, is a product oriented process that is done to identify the defects in the finished product. Qa focuses on improving the processes to deliver quality products to the customer.

The term quality assurance describes a set of planned, systematic actions to ensure that products and. The quality plan selects those organizational standards that are appropriate to a particular. Software quality management sqm is a management process that aims to develop and manage the quality of software in such a way so as to best ensure that the product meets the quality standards. The quality plan selects those organizational standards that are appropriate to a particular product and development process. The scope of this document is to outline all procedures, techniques and tools to be used for quality assurance of this project. The quality management plan is a component of the project management plan that describes how applicable policies, procedures, and guidelines will be implemented to achieve the quality objectives. For example, you use the schedule and cost baselines to determine the quality of the project performance.

Plan quality management inputs and outputs on the pmp. Software quality assurance plan sqap consists of those procedures, techniques and tools used to ensure that a product meets the requirements specified in software requirements specification. The requirements and activities identified herein, form the basis for the development of project. Quality assurance is a set of activities designed to ensure that the. To assist in breaking down the requirements of a pqp, the following tables identify what is looked at when your pqp is audited and the requirements under iso5. It focuses more on the software process rather than the software work products. Project quality plan pqp designing buildings wiki share your construction industry knowledge. The rational unified process recommends that the software engineering process authority sepa be responsible for the process component of quality assurance. The project quality plan pqp is a written plan which serves as the basis for the overall project quality assurance system and identifies the quality requirements, methods to achieve project quality. The quality management plan is an integral part of any project management plan. Quality assurance program plan, basic systems, implement. The quality plan defines the quality requirements of software and describes how these are to be assessed. Abbreviated as sqap, the software quality assurance plan comprises of the procedures, techniques, and tools that are employed to make sure that a product or service aligns with the requirements defined in the srs software requirement specification. Software quality assurance plan example department of energy.

Designed specifically for manufacturing companies, quality collaboration by design qcbd is an integrated quality management software for managing all your quality data. This includes flight and qualification hardware, software, firmware, and critical ground support equipment gse. Easily create different versions of your roadmap for different audiences to. A quality plan is a document, or several documents, that together specify quality standards, practices, resources, specifications, and the sequence of activities relevant to a particular product, service, project, or contract. The purpose of this software quality assurance plan sqap is to define the techniques, procedures, and methodologies that will be used at the center for space research csr to assure timely delivery of. The main purpose of a quality plan is to establish the quality of a project, product or service to meet the customers expectation regarding the quality and the satisfaction made by a particular product, service, or project. A quality assurance plan is a document, constructed by the project team, meant to ensure the final products are of the utmost quality. This metrics describe the project characteristics and execution. It presents quality assurance processes, methods, and techniques used to evaluate projects during the execution phase.

207 1308 321 638 846 1590 1225 1523 270 417 145 990 1446 369 1089 1368 1178 1492 1197 1060 285 636 398 538 1246 382 845 380 730 854 508 1191 821 463 6 274 1374 1104